From 2d7efbf341119197e1eecffad7a0818db6e1ae43 Mon Sep 17 00:00:00 2001 From: Frank Hossfeld Date: Sun, 13 Oct 2024 10:31:26 +0200 Subject: [PATCH 1/2] set version to 2.20.1 --- README.md | 36 ++++++++++++++----- .../ApplicationWithFilterImpl.java | 2 +- .../com/github/nalukit/nalu/client/Nalu.java | 2 +- .../github/nalukit/nalu/client/NaluTest.java | 2 +- pom.xml | 2 +- 5 files changed, 32 insertions(+), 12 deletions(-) diff --git a/README.md b/README.md index 32e35ec3..8fd44798 100644 --- a/README.md +++ b/README.md @@ -4,7 +4,7 @@ ![GWT3/J2CL compatible](https://img.shields.io/badge/GWT3/J2CL-compatible-brightgreen.svg) [![Join the chat at https://gitter.im/Nalukit42/Lobby](https://badges.gitter.im/Nalukit42/Lobby.svg)](https://gitter.im/Nalukit42/Lobby?utm_source=badge&utm_medium=badge&utm_campaign=pr-badge&utm_content=badge) [![Maven Central](https://img.shields.io/maven-central/v/com.github.nalukit/nalu.svg?colorB=44cc11)](https://central.sonatype.com/artifact/com.github.nalukit/nalu) -[![Build & Deploy](https://github.com/NaluKit/nalu/actions/workflows/build.yaml/badge.svg?branch=dev)](https://github.com/NaluKit/nalu/actions/workflows/build.yaml) +[![Build & Deploy](https://github.com/NaluKit/nalu/actions/workflows/build.yaml/badge.svg?branch=main)](https://github.com/NaluKit/nalu/actions/workflows/build.yaml) Nalu is a tiny framework that helps you to create GWT based applications quite easily. Using the HTML 5 history for routing and navigation, Nalu supports the browser's back-, forward-, and reload-button by default and without any need to implement anything. @@ -136,12 +136,12 @@ To use Nalu add the following dependencies to your pom: com.github.nalukit nalu - 2.20.0 + 2.20.1 com.github.nalukit nalu-processor - 2.20.0 + 2.20.1 provided ``` @@ -156,6 +156,7 @@ If the project uses a widget set based on **Elemental2**, **Elemento** or **Domi com.github.nalukit nalu-plugin-elemental2 2.10.1-gwt-2.8.2 + ``` * **GWT 2.9.0 (and newer) - SNAPSHOT** @@ -164,6 +165,7 @@ If the project uses a widget set based on **Elemental2**, **Elemento** or **Domi com.github.nalukit nalu-plugin-elemental2 HEAD-SNAPSHOT + ``` * **GWT 2.9.0 (and newer) - Release** @@ -171,7 +173,7 @@ If the project uses a widget set based on **Elemental2**, **Elemento** or **Domi com.github.nalukit nalu-plugin-elemental2 - 2.20.0 + 2.20.1 ``` @@ -200,11 +202,29 @@ For Elemento there's a dedicated plugin which supports `org.jboss.gwt.elemento.c com.github.nalukit nalu-plugin-elemento - 2.20.0 + 2.20.1 ``` -The **nalu-plugin-elemento** can also be used with Domino-ui. +For Domino-UI Version 2 there's also a dedicated plugin which supports `org.dominokit.domino.ui.IsElement` as widget type: + +* **GWT 2.9.0 (and newer) - SNAPSHOT** +```XML + + com.github.nalukit + nalu-plugin-domino-v2 + HEAD-SNAPSHOT + +``` + +* **GWT 2.9.0 (and newer) - Release** +```XML + + com.github.nalukit + nalu-plugin-domino-v2 + 2.20.1 + +``` **(These plugins are ready to use with J2CL / GWT 3)** @@ -245,12 +265,12 @@ If your project uses a widget set based on **GWT** 2.8.2 or newer, use the **Nal com.github.nalukit nalu-plugin-gwt - 2.20.0 + 2.20.1 com.github.nalukit nalu-plugin-gwt-processor - 2.20.0 + 2.20.1 provided ``` diff --git a/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java b/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java index f5e08278..f1b591d5 100644 --- a/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java +++ b/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java @@ -34,7 +34,7 @@ public void logProcessorVersion() { this.eventBus.fireEvent(LogEvent.create() .sdmOnly(true) .addMessage("=================================================================================") - .addMessage("Nalu processor version >>HEAD-SNAPSHOT<< used to generate this source") + .addMessage("Nalu processor version >>2.20.1<< used to generate this source") .addMessage("=================================================================================") .addMessage("")); } diff --git a/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java b/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java index 4e71c08f..36b2c936 100644 --- a/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java +++ b/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java @@ -23,7 +23,7 @@ public class Nalu { public static String getVersion() { // TODO Change this for other versions - return "HEAD-SNAPSHOT"; + return "2.20.1"; } public static boolean hasHistory() { diff --git a/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java b/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java index 0d191cee..098a191a 100644 --- a/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java +++ b/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java @@ -14,7 +14,7 @@ public class NaluTest { void getVersion() throws IOException { // TODO Change this if you want to test against another version - Assertions.assertEquals("HEAD-SNAPSHOT", + Assertions.assertEquals("2.20.1", Nalu.getVersion()); } diff --git a/pom.xml b/pom.xml index a6783fec..9ca28e40 100644 --- a/pom.xml +++ b/pom.xml @@ -87,7 +87,7 @@ - HEAD-SNAPSHOT + 2.20.1 1.2.2 1.1.1 From f0ad62a9d8b066313bc60720a76182e8877b04f9 Mon Sep 17 00:00:00 2001 From: Frank Hossfeld Date: Sun, 13 Oct 2024 10:50:36 +0200 Subject: [PATCH 2/2] start new iteration --- .github/workflows/build.yaml | 2 +- .../e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java | 2 +- n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java | 2 +- n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java | 2 +- pom.xml | 2 +- 5 files changed, 5 insertions(+), 5 deletions(-)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index f9cce825..2f6adcb0 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-171,7 +171,7 @@ jobs: exit 1 if: ${{ steps.version-check.outputs.already-exists == 'true' }} - name: Release - uses: softprops/action-gh-release@v1 + uses: softprops/action-gh-release@v2 with: body: Relase of version ${{ steps.project.outputs.version }} tag_name: ${{ steps.project.outputs.version }} diff --git a/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java b/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java index f1b591d5..f5e08278 100644 --- a/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java +++ b/nalu-processor/src/test/resources/com/github/nalukit/nalu/processor.templates/filter/eventhandler/eventHandlerOnAFilterOk02/ApplicationWithFilterImpl.java @@ -34,7 +34,7 @@ public void logProcessorVersion() { this.eventBus.fireEvent(LogEvent.create() .sdmOnly(true) .addMessage("=================================================================================") - .addMessage("Nalu processor version >>2.20.1<< used to generate this source") + .addMessage("Nalu processor version >>HEAD-SNAPSHOT<< used to generate this source") .addMessage("=================================================================================") .addMessage("")); } diff --git a/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java b/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java index 36b2c936..4e71c08f 100644 --- a/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java +++ b/nalu/src/main/java/com/github/nalukit/nalu/client/Nalu.java @@ -23,7 +23,7 @@ public class Nalu { public static String getVersion() { // TODO Change this for other versions - return "2.20.1"; + return "HEAD-SNAPSHOT"; } public static boolean hasHistory() { diff --git a/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java b/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java index 098a191a..0d191cee 100644 --- a/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java +++ b/nalu/src/test/java/com/github/nalukit/nalu/client/NaluTest.java @@ -14,7 +14,7 @@ public class NaluTest { void getVersion() throws IOException { // TODO Change this if you want to test against another version - Assertions.assertEquals("2.20.1", + Assertions.assertEquals("HEAD-SNAPSHOT", Nalu.getVersion()); } diff --git a/pom.xml b/pom.xml index 9ca28e40..a6783fec 100644 --- a/pom.xml +++ b/pom.xml @@ -87,7 +87,7 @@ - 2.20.1 + HEAD-SNAPSHOT 1.2.2 1.1.1